Q: Is 757,743,234 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 757,743,234 is not a prime number.

Why is 757,743,234 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 757743234 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 23 46 69 138 401 802 1,203 2,406 9,223 13,693 18,446 27,386 27,669 41,079 55,338 82,158 314,939 629,878 944,817 1,889,634 5,490,893 10,981,786 16,472,679 32,945,358 126,290,539 252,581,078 378,871,617 and 757,743,234, with no remainder.

Since 757,743,234 cannot be divided by just 1 and 757,743,234, it is not a prime number.
